Compare Westminster to Goleta

This post compares Westminster, California to Goleta, California across various dimensions, including population, median income, median age, percentage of housing that is rental, percent of households with kids, and other demographics.

Dimension Westminster (city) Goleta (city)
Population 91,785 30,847
Income (median) $43,283 $51,866
Home Value (median) $546,200 $718,300
White 39% 69%
Black 0% 1%
Asian 48% 8%
With Kids 35% 32%
Age (median) 41 36
Rentals 47% 47%
